Find and Book Top Rated Hotels in Prague

Search among 597 available hotels and places to stay in Prague from 50+ providers

Check-in
Select date
Check-out
Select date
Rooms & Guests
22 Guests, 1 Room
Filter & Sort
View map
1-50 out of 597
Filter & Sort
View map
Sort by: high popularity
  • Price: low to high
  • Price: high to low
  • Guest rating: high to low
  • Popularity: high to low
8.4
Great890 reviews
MapView on map1700 yd from City Center1300 yd from Prague Main Railway Station
From   US$ 137 /nightSelect
8.2
Great190 reviews
MapView on map500 yd from City Center400 yd from Charles Bridge
From   US$ 642 /nightSelect
8.2
Great374 reviews
900 yd from City Center700 yd from Charles University
From   US$ 164 /nightSelect
8.4
Great468 reviews
900 yd from City Center700 yd from Charles University
From   US$ 238 /nightSelect
Hotel
8.6
Great491 reviews
1.6 mi from City Center1500 yd from Prague Main Railway Station
From   US$ 81 /nightSelect
8.8
Great117 reviews
1200 yd from City Center500 yd from Prague Castle
From   US$ 381 /nightSelect
8.4
Great337 reviews
800 yd from City Center500 yd from Charles University
From   US$ 154 /nightSelect
8.6
Great1630 reviews
1.8 mi from City Center300 yd from Congress Centre Prague
From   US$ 96 /nightSelect
8.6
Great379 reviews
700 yd from City Center300 yd from Charles Bridge
From   US$ 313 /nightSelect
8.6
Great811 reviews
500 yd from City Center300 yd from Charles University
From   US$ 170 /nightSelect
8.4
Great695 reviews
600 yd from City Center400 yd from Charles University
From   US$ 238 /nightSelect
8.4
Great957 reviews
800 yd from City Center600 yd from Charles University
From   US$ 107 /nightSelect
8.6
Great104 reviews
1400 yd from City Center500 yd from St. Vitus Cathedral
From   US$ 258 /nightSelect
8.6
Great38 reviews
900 yd from City Center600 yd from Prague Main Railway Station
From   US$ 418 /nightSelect
900 yd from City Center700 yd from Prague Main Railway Station
From   US$ 418 /nightSelect
8.4
Great83 reviews
1300 yd from City Center600 yd from Charles Bridge
From   US$ 438 /nightSelect
200 yd from City Center200 yd from Prague Astronomical Clock
From   US$ 124 /nightSelect
8.4
Great177 reviews
600 yd from City Center500 yd from Charles University
From   US$ 226 /nightSelect
8.6
Great330 reviews
1.8 mi from City Center1700 yd from Eden Stadium
From   US$ 159 /nightSelect
8.6
Great1589 reviews
700 yd from City Center400 yd from Charles University
From   US$ 197 /nightSelect
Hostel
8.6
Great228 reviews
1.6 mi from City Center1600 yd from Prague Main Railway Station
From   US$ 15 /nightSelect
8.4
Great899 reviews
1000 yd from City Center500 yd from Prague Main Railway Station
From   US$ 102 /nightSelect
8.6
Great980 reviews
1000 yd from City Center900 yd from Charles University
From   US$ 111 /nightSelect
8.6
Great1719 reviews
From   US$ 92 /nightSelect
8.6
Great882 reviews
600 yd from City Center600 yd from Charles University
From   US$ 91 /nightSelect
8.2
Great423 reviews
1300 yd from City Center1200 yd from Prague Astronomical Clock
From   US$ 162 /nightSelect
Hotel
8.4
Great148 reviews
600 yd from City Center400 yd from Charles University
From   US$ 165 /nightSelect
8.4
Great1200 reviews
900 yd from City Center700 yd from Charles University
From   US$ 92 /nightSelect
8.4
Great460 reviews
200 yd from City Center100 yd from Prague Astronomical Clock
From   US$ 202 /nightSelect
8.6
Great383 reviews
300 yd from City Center100 yd from Charles University
From   US$ 142 /nightSelect
8.4
Great414 reviews
200 yd from City Center100 yd from Prague Astronomical Clock
From   US$ 136 /nightSelect
8.6
Great1023 reviews
1.5 mi from City Center600 yd from Novy Smichov shopping centre
From   US$ 88 /nightSelect
8.6
Great796 reviews
1100 yd from City Center400 yd from Charles Bridge
From   US$ 98 /nightSelect
Hotel
8.6
Great1203 reviews
200 yd from City Center200 yd from Prague Astronomical Clock
From   US$ 151 /nightSelect
8.4
Great450 reviews
300 yd from City Center200 yd from Prague Astronomical Clock
From   US$ 154 /nightSelect
Hotel
8.6
Great129 reviews
1300 yd from City Center300 yd from Prague Castle
From   US$ 358 /nightSelect
8.6
Great1195 reviews
1300 yd from City Center1200 yd from Prague Astronomical Clock
From   US$ 165 /nightSelect
8.4
Great615 reviews
800 yd from City Center600 yd from Charles University
From   US$ 99 /nightSelect
8.4
Great283 reviews
1100 yd from City Center1000 yd from Charles Bridge
From   US$ 236 /nightSelect
8.4
Great626 reviews
1100 yd from City Center500 yd from Prague Main Railway Station
From   US$ 371 /nightSelect
8.2
Great723 reviews
600 yd from City Center300 yd from Charles Bridge
From   US$ 59 /nightSelect
8.6
Great908 reviews
1.4 mi from City Center1200 yd from Congress Centre Prague
From   US$ 114 /nightSelect
8.6
Great1670 reviews
2.8 mi from City Center1800 yd from Congress Centre Prague
From   US$ 87 /nightSelect
8.2
Great404 reviews
1300 yd from City Center500 yd from Prague Main Railway Station
From   US$ 148 /nightSelect
Hotel
8.4
Great644 reviews
4.0 mi from City Center300 yd from
From   US$ 74 /nightSelect
8.4
Great744 reviews
400 yd from City Center200 yd from Charles University
From   US$ 185 /nightSelect
8.6
Great608 reviews
1600 yd from City Center1100 yd from Prague Main Railway Station
From   US$ 94 /nightSelect
8.2
Great330 reviews
500 yd from City Center600 yd from Old Town Square
From   US$ 124 /nightSelect
8.4
Great174 reviews
1.6 mi from City Center900 yd from
From   US$ 15 /nightSelect
8.6
Great956 reviews
1100 yd from City Center900 yd from Prague Main Railway Station
From   US$ 273 /nightSelect

Best Hotels and Places to Stay in Prague

Why visit?

Prague, the capital of the Czech Republic, offers a unique blend of rich history, stunning architecture, and vibrant culture. With its picturesque streets, fairy-tale-like castles, and charming atmosphere, Prague attracts tourists from around the world. Whether you are interested in exploring historical landmarks, indulging in delicious Czech cuisine, or immersing yourself in the local arts scene, Prague has something for everyone.

Where to stay?

When choosing the best areas to stay in Prague, it is important to consider proximity to major attractions, convenience, and the overall ambiance of the neighborhood. The following neighborhoods are highly recommended for tourists:

Old Town (Staré Město):

This area is the heart of Prague and an ideal location for first-time visitors. Here, you will find the iconic Charles Bridge, the Old Town Square with the Astronomical Clock, and numerous other historical sites. Old Town offers a variety of accommodation options suitable for every budget.

Lesser Town (Malá Strana):

Situated on the left bank of the Vltava River, Lesser Town is filled with picturesque cobblestone streets, Baroque architecture, and beautiful gardens. Its proximity to Prague Castle makes it an attractive area to stay in. There are plenty of charming hotels and guesthouses available here.

Vinohrady:

Known for its trendy cafes, bars, and restaurants, Vinohrady is a popular residential area that offers a more local experience. The neighborhood boasts beautiful art nouveau buildings and peaceful parks. Vinohrady is slightly removed from the city center but is well-connected by public transport.

Price per hotel room per night:

The average price of hotel rooms in Prague varies depending on the hotel's star rating. Here is an overview of the average prices:

3-star hotels: $60-$100

4-star hotels: $100-$200

5-star hotels: $200 and above

Best Value for Money:

Hotel Pod Vezi: Located near the Charles Bridge, this 4-star hotel offers comfortable rooms, a rooftop terrace, and stunning views of Prague Castle.

Hotel Kampa Garden: Situated in Lesser Town, this budget-friendly 3-star hotel provides cozy accommodation, friendly staff, and a convenient location.

Best Kids-Friendly Hotels:

Art Deco Imperial Hotel: With spacious rooms, a children's play area, and a central location near Wenceslas Square, this 5-star hotel caters well to families.

Hotel Caesar Prague: This 4-star hotel offers family rooms, a children's menu at the restaurant, and is located near the Prague Zoo and botanical garden.

Best Hotels for a Romantic Getaway:

Aria Hotel Prague: This luxury 5-star hotel in Lesser Town combines music-inspired design, exceptional service, and a rooftop terrace with panoramic views.

Hotel Golden Key: Situated near Prague Castle, this 4-star boutique hotel features stylish rooms, a lovely courtyard, and a romantic atmosphere.

Best for Location:

Hotel U Prince: Located in the heart of Old Town, this 5-star hotel offers elegant rooms and a rooftop restaurant with stunning views of the Prague skyline.

Hilton Prague Old Town: Situated in the city center, this well-known 5-star hotel provides comfortable rooms, a fitness center, and easy access to popular sights.

Best for a Short City Break:

MOODs Boutique Hotel: This 4-star hotel, located in the New Town area, offers modern and spacious rooms, a cozy bar, and is within walking distance of major attractions.

Hotel Three Storks: Nestled in Lesser Town, this boutique hotel offers individually designed rooms, a rooftop terrace, and a prime location near Prague Castle.

Show moreLess